Some of the charter members were the Bynum, Davis and Green Families beginning with Reverend Ananias Buck and Reverend Bazemore. Rev. Buck held the flock together with the help of Rev. Bazemore.
In 1873, these charted members were loyal and eager to venture out. Under Reverend Buck's leadership, the first frame building was constructed. The Church began to grow in membership and success marked their pathway.
